Output 758f74c863f60362508be04d8871339256e07d0c9a5edbb5b42a0547310f1618:0

value
145139
script pubkey
OP_0 OP_PUSHBYTES_20 66cc916980d4b113613e13e696944821133df64b
address
bc1qvmxfz6vq6jc3xcf7z0nfd9zgyyfnmajtl47wtv
transaction
758f74c863f60362508be04d8871339256e07d0c9a5edbb5b42a0547310f1618
confirmations
62610
spent
true